Deen Sharp
Deen Sharp
is an LSE Fellow in Human Geography at the London School of Economics and co-editor with the late Michael Sorkin of Open Gaza.
is an LSE Fellow in Human Geography at the London School of Economics and co-editor with the late Michael Sorkin of Open Gaza.
Sign up to receive email updates from YES!